Ordinals
beta
Sat 714635937304624
decimal
142927.937304624
degree
0°142927′1807″937304624‴
percentile
34.03028276622494%
name
iuczqefokgf
cycle
0
epoch
0
period
70
block
142927
offset
937304624
timestamp
2011-08-28 15:35:12 UTC
rarity
common
prev
next